本文深入解析了搭建VPN访问内网的方法,旨在实现安全高效的网络连接。通过详细步骤和案例分析,展示了如何利用VPN技术突破地域限制,确保数据传输的安全性,为企业和个人提供便捷的网络访问解决方案。
随着互联网的广泛应用,网络安全与个人隐私保护成为企业和个人日益关注的焦点,为了满足这一需求,VPN(虚拟专用网络)技术应运而生,通过先进的加密技术,VPN能够确保数据传输的安全性及用户隐私的保护,本文将深入探讨如何搭建VPN以访问内网,并指导用户实现安全且高效的网络连接体验。
搭建VPN访问内网的详细步骤
1. 准备工作
(1)准备一台服务器:可以是云服务器、VPS或者自有的服务器。
(2)选择合适的VPN软件:例如OpenVPN、Shadowsocks等。
(3)确保内网设备准备就绪:如路由器、交换机等。
2. 服务器配置
(1)选择服务器并安装操作系统,如CentOS、Ubuntu等。
(2)安装VPN软件,以OpenVPN为例,使用以下命令进行安装:
sudo apt-get install openvpn easy-rsa
(3)配置OpenVPN:
① 生成CA证书:
cd /etc/openvpn/easy-rsa
source ./vars
./clean-all
./build-ca
② 生成服务器证书和私钥:
./build-key-server server
③ 生成DH参数:
./build-dh
④ 生成客户端证书和私钥:
./build-key client1
⑤ 生成客户端配置文件:
./build-key client2
3. 客户端配置
(1)将服务器生成的CA证书、服务器证书、客户端证书、私钥以及dh2048.pem文件下载至本地。
(2)在VPN软件中导入证书,并根据需要设置连接参数。
4. 内网设备配置
(1)将内网设备(如路由器、交换机)设置为NAT模式。
(2)对内网设备进行配置,设置静态IP地址和子网掩码。
5. 连接VPN
(1)启动VPN软件,连接至服务器。
(2)等待连接成功,此时您的电脑将获得内网IP地址。
(3)通过浏览器或命令行工具访问内网资源。
搭建VPN访问内网的优势
1. 安全性:VPN通过加密技术保障用户数据在传输过程中的安全性和隐私。
2. 灵活性:VPN支持多种操作系统和设备,使用便捷。
3. 可靠性:VPN连接稳定,确保用户访问内网资源的顺畅。
4. 成本效益:通过搭建VPN访问内网,企业可以降低内部网络建设的成本。
搭建VPN访问内网是确保网络连接安全与高效的有效方法,通过本文的指导,相信您已经掌握了搭建VPN访问内网的方法,在实际操作中,请严格遵守相关法律法规,合理使用VPN技术,持续关注网络安全动态,提升个人网络安全意识,共同维护网络环境的和谐与稳定。